The Real Reasons Behind Tamilyogi Access Restrictions

Due to the nature of its content, Tamilyogi operates under heightened network supervision and risk-control scrutiny. The platform does not rely solely on domain availability to determine access permissions. Instead, it evaluates multiple factors, including traffic source, IP history, connection patterns, and overall traffic characteristics.

When requests originate from data centers, public cloud servers, or heavily reused proxy endpoints, these IPs often carry accumulated risk labels. Even if access is possible for a short time, subsequent restrictions are highly likely. This explains why many users experience situations where the site works briefly and then becomes inaccessible again.

From the platform’s perspective, these restrictions are not targeted at individuals but are automated filtering mechanisms designed to identify abnormal network environments.


Why Ordinary Proxies Fail for Long-Term Tamilyogi Access

Many users initially choose low-cost or simple proxy services. These proxies usually share common traits: concentrated IP sources, highly similar outbound behavior, and easily identifiable request patterns. For scenarios that require long-term stability, such proxies are fundamentally inadequate.

When multiple users access the same platform through identical or similar network paths, recognizable behavior patterns quickly form. Once these patterns are flagged, all subsequent traffic using the same routes is affected. This is why frequent IP switching does not truly solve the problem and may even accelerate detection.

A genuinely effective solution must address the core issue: network authenticity.


How Residential Proxy IPs Change the Access Logic

The key difference between residential proxies and ordinary proxies is their origin. Residential proxy IPs come from real household ISP networks rather than server data centers. From the platform’s perspective, these IPs more closely resemble normal user traffic in terms of network structure, routing paths, and historical behavior.

When requests to Tamilyogi originate from residential networks, their overall characteristics are no longer centralized or abnormal. Instead, they are distributed across global household networks, significantly reducing the likelihood of centralized detection and blocking. This makes the access behavior more acceptable to platform systems.

However, not all residential proxies deliver the same results. Factors such as IP pool size, regional distribution density, and anonymity configuration quality directly affect access outcomes.


The Role of Stability and Anonymity in Long-Term Access

Many users focus on whether a site “can be opened,” but what truly defines the experience is whether it can be used consistently over time. In environments like Tamilyogi, short-term access success is relatively easy; long-term stability is the real challenge.

At this stage, IP cleanliness and anonymity levels become decisive factors. If a proxy leaks relay information at the protocol level or exposes obvious proxy characteristics in request headers, platforms can still gradually identify and restrict access.

High-anonymity residential proxies address these issues by closely replicating real user request behavior, making traffic technically indistinguishable and significantly reducing the risk of triggering platform defenses.
